The Communications and Multimedia Minister, Datuk Seri Salleh Said Keruak said in his latest blog posting that many people were abusing the Internet and embarking on campaigns of “lies and misinformation” instead of using the online platform to exchange ideas and opinions in a civil manner. He also pointed out that freedom of speech has its limits and must be seen as a privilege that can be taken away if abused instead of an absolute right. So, we're asking you today, should freedom of expression be treated as a privilege or an absolute right? Our lines will be open.
